Appointment of Cabinet Ministers dragged in indefinitely

The appointment of new Cabinet Ministers is likely to be dragged in indefinitely, given the absence of a final decision on the affair, political sources disclosed.

Last week, 37 state ministers were appointed, but no Cabinet was appointed simultaneously.

President Wickremesinghe is set to leave for the United Kingdom to attend the funeral of Her Majesty, Queen Elizabeth the Second, but he is also on schedule to leave for Japan on an official tour prior to his visit to the Royal Family.

Meanwhile, the pending necessity to pass the proposed 22nd Amendment to the Constitution in Parliament is also on his way, hence the appointment of the new Cabinet being dragged in indefinitely.
